ABOUT THE LIBRARY FUND OF THE NAA

The Library was opened in 1996. This Library, which meets the state-of-the-art requirements, has built its activity pursuant to the demands of the Law of the Republic of Azerbaijan “On Librarianship”, orders and decrees of the “Azerbaijan Airlines” CJSC, National Aviation Academy, other legal acts regulating the activity of the library.

The library started its rapid development after the commissioning, and the main focus was on the acquisition of the collection. Each printed product included in our fund is presented with a bibliographic description of all types of publications reflected in the e-catalogue. In total, there are more than 80,000 printed materials (books, magazines, brochures, etc.), more than 16,000 electronic resources in Azerbaijani, Russian and English languages in the Library Fund. The Library Fund of the National Aviation Academy has been enriched with scientific-technical, educational-methodical and reference literature. In the current year, the number of readers in the library was 2,974 persons.

The Fund includes materials on Air Transport Flight Operations, Air Transport Maintenance, Electronics, Telecommunications, Radio Technology, Information Technology and Systems, Instrumentation, Ecology, Hydrometeorology, Management, Economics, Law, Navigation, Aviation Engineering, Special Equipment and Instrumentation, Physics, Mathematics, Chemistry, Meteorology, Air Transport Technologies, Process and Production Safety, Air Traffic Management, Aviation, Humanities and Fiction, including Foreign Language and other Textbooks, Teaching Aids, Guidelines, Technical and Regulatory Documentation, Maps and Atlases, as well as other documents.

The NAA Library envisages the introduction of modern information technologies and the creation of a computerised library infrastructure.
Currently, the Academy’s Library is working with Destiny Library Manager (Integrated Library Management System), a product of the American company Follet.
